How much do part time process eng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 23, 2026, the average yearly pay for part time process engineer in Columbia, SC is $85,129.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$68,900.00 and $95,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What other jobs can a process engineer do?

A process engineer can transition into roles such as manufacturing engineer, quality engineer, operations manager, or project engineer, leveraging skills in process optimization, data analysis, and problem-solving. They may also work in supply chain management or product development, often requiring knowledge of industry standards and tools like Six Sigma or CAD software.

What are part time process engineers?

Part time process engineers are professionals who work reduced or flexible hours—rather than a traditional full-time schedule—to analyze, design, and optimize industrial processes within manufacturing or production environments. Their responsibilities may include improving efficiency, ensuring quality control, troubleshooting process issues, and implementing new technologies, all while working fewer hours per week. This role is ideal for those seeking work-life balance or who have other commitments, while still applying their engineering expertise to contribute significantly to organizational goals.

What is the difference between Part Time Process Engineer vs Full Time Process Engineer?

AspectPart Time Process EngineerFull Time Process Engineer
Work HoursLess than 40 hours/weekTypically 40 hours/week or more
ResponsibilitiesAssists in process optimization, limited project scopeLeads process improvements, manages projects
CredentialsRelevant engineering degree, certifications optionalSame as part time, often with more experience
Work EnvironmentOften part-time roles in manufacturing or industrial settingsFull-time roles in similar environments

The main difference between a Part Time Process Engineer and a Full Time Process Engineer lies in work hours and scope of responsibilities. Part time roles typically involve fewer hours and limited project involvement, while full-time positions require a greater commitment and leadership in process improvements. Both roles generally require similar educational backgrounds and certifications, but the full-time role often demands more experience and responsibility.

Job Description

Reports directly to the Molding Engineering Supervisor. Will perform all phases of new product development/introduction to include: molding validations from setting up and starting a new mold to writing the needed documentation to interface between Divisional Molding, Manufacturing Process Technologies and assembly areas to insure all essential requirements are satisfied. Duties will also include providing the Molding Department with technical assistance and training as required

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S

  • Organize, plan, and execute activities to insure proper mold validations are performed
  • Develop a consistent, quality process on new molds and products.
  • Monitor and Document processes as IM department requires
  • Write validation documents and department specifications.
  • Install prototype molds and ancillary equipment.
  • Assist Molding Process Engineers with Department projects.
  • Provide Technical assistance to the Injection Molding Department as required.
  • Work directly with Mold Approval Technician on part measurements
  • Provide technical input and training as required.
  • Provide technical information needed to maintain capital expenses budget.
  • Provides assistance in all phases of Budget and Standards preparation
  • Observe all safety and environmental procedures and good manufacturing practices
  • Proposes and implements changes in plant processes and equipment to increase efficiency and improve overall cost positions.

ADDITIONAL R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Performs other duties as directed by the Molding Engineering Supervisor or Injection Molding Business Unit Manager.
  • Work Flexible Hours with Overtime being required at times.

JOB QUALIFICATIONS

  • H.S. Diploma/G.E.D. (if hired after 6/1/00) Internal transfers exempted
  • Certified RJG Master Molder 1 or higher

Experience and Knowledge

  • 8 years of Injection Molding Plastic Processing experience in a technical role
  • Requires a high degree of technical skill and experience in Injection Molding processing with a wide variety of polymers, high cavitation tools, and robotic automation. Critical skills needed are a working knowledge of injection molding equipment and the ability to recognize, define and correct equipment/ tooling deficiencies. This position also requires the ability to collaborate with various other support groups (i.e., Facilities, Tool Shop, etc) to implement equipment installation and improvements.
  • Knowledge of current technology and state of the art in a wide variety of disciplines with familiarity in electronic controls, hydraulics, and pneumatics, standards development and statistical engineering, OSHA and FDA validation requirements.
  • Knowledge of PLC Operations, Maintenance and Programming and the ability to read schematics or machining, tooling design, tooling assembly and the ability to read part drawings.
